Charlie Thorburn has been training dogs for 25 years and welcomes you to the DogFather, a show which talks to people from all countries and walks of life about how dogs have impacted their lives and businesses. New episode every week.

“Springers Are Spaniels, But Cockers Are Little People” — Charlie vs. Edward Martin
Q: So Springer versus Cocker, which would you recommend for a family that shoots as well?
For a combined shooting and family dog, a Cocker is often the better all-round choice, whereas a Springer tends to be more work-focused and energetic; it really depends on whether you value a steadier family presence or higher drive in the field.

They Ship Dogs All Around The World: But How Do They Do It? - Airpets
Q: What are the key regulatory frameworks that guide Airpets today?
The company operates under IRTA accreditation and live animal regulations, with IATA standards and border-control stipulations guiding paperwork, insurance, and staff training to ensure compliant handling of live animals across borders.
They Ship Dogs All Around The World: But How Do They Do It? - Airpets
Q: How did the business evolve from a boarding kennel to an international pet shipping service?
It started with a pilot asking to look after a dog while away, expanded to quarantine services, and gradually shifted focus to transport logistics as regulations and demand changed, especially near Heathrow, where the team leveraged their location to become a one-stop shop for paperwork, vet checks, and crate readiness.

Frequently Asked Questions About The DogFather

What is The DogFather about and what kind of topics does it cover?

A deep dive into professional dog training, breeding, and related entrepreneurship, with a focus on gundogs, working spaniels, and the business side of canine ventures. Episodes span practical training philosophies, breed differences, cross-border breeding and import/export considerations, and the growth of family-owned operations into international brands. Listeners get candid takes on training tools, ethics, and the challenges of running multiple ventures—from kennels and training facilities to hospitality estates and pet shipping services. Notable angles include transplanting traditional Gundog wisdom to modern markets, expanding from a regional operation to a global network, and building transparent brands around hands-on expertise.
